Output 324dddccc92a8cd26c11b6b7a13dfd13cc2f8a9e86cff67f2e0d6667c889fa69:0

value
954000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c86dd8b47e7ea82c9e88c2777aefdef8d8ed71 OP_EQUAL
address
3LT6Yvfr9ruEJBPSX2Vv385uY5jJYKxpY8
transaction
324dddccc92a8cd26c11b6b7a13dfd13cc2f8a9e86cff67f2e0d6667c889fa69
confirmations
323096
spent
true